Taiwanese Wafer Manufacturers Turn Sights to Mid-to-High Range LED Market

A mature LED market has seen a surge in demands this year. Upstream die manufacturers one by one are transforming their market strategies in response to continual decrease in prices. Chinese manufacturer Hong Hai has been dropping prices rapidly in the mid-to-low range LED market. Taiwanese wafer manufactures have turned to the mid-to-high range LED market in order to maintain their gross margin performance. Flip Chip technology has become this year’s new battle ground with companies like Epistar and Genesis vigorously racing to start production.
